25. Cattle News: Weekly Outlook
Lafayette, IN - The most prominent feature of the cattle outlook for 2007 is the painful adjustment to much higher feed prices. After three years of favorable returns, 2007 is expected to be close to breakeven, with concerns that even higher feed prices could drive the industry into losses. 27. Cattle News: Oswalds honored for conservation efforts
His current goal is to open up more feed for his cows and provide forage for the nearly 500 head neighborhood elk herd and keep them off his lower elevation forage base. Steve selects mostly Black Angus cattle for his herd that have low birth weights and are easy fleshing. Steve starts each year with an annual grazing plan for his 95 cows and 30 yearling steers. 29. Cattle News: Archibalds expand ranch with shop; 6000 cattle feedyard
The ranch enterprise includes a 6,000-head capacity feedyard, a substantial Black Angus cow/calf herd, acres of farm land that grow feed grain, and a unique welding business - Archibald Brothers Land & Cattle Shop Division - that builds and sells its own cattle working equipment and supplies.
